And in Jackson, I stumbled onto what may be the coolest Ferrari art in the world!
A Frog sculpture called "Enzo" by artist Tim Cotterill, the "Frogman".

Price: $1,500
Size of sculpture: 21" X 12.5" X 3.25"
Edition size 399, just like the Enzo.
(25 Yellow, 25 Green, 349 Red)
